Output 23f5159c6f266e2faa41cd0678e7a07bc8e3e1f26740f8a7bc3bcf6b8ec98632:0

value
49992318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240b14172ab29ecfcc04bd5434768e7e48e9a404 OP_EQUAL
address
34ybXCK2LKvF1MFfsFz675Au3kW8vBBhxS
transaction
23f5159c6f266e2faa41cd0678e7a07bc8e3e1f26740f8a7bc3bcf6b8ec98632
spent
true